Chapter 74 Reaching a tacit agreement

"Boom!"

Suddenly there was a thunder outside, and then it started to rain.

The weather is so changeable, just like life.

Dumbledore looked from the window at the rain falling from the sky, and asked calmly: "When will we go back?"

Hao Fang naturally knew what the other party meant. He was asking when he would return to Harry Potter world!

He was secretly happy that this old man looked quite calm on the surface, but in fact he was quite anxious.

Because even Hao Fang could not imagine what kind of earth-shattering changes would happen to the wizarding world without Dumbledore.

In particular, it was a critical period when Dumbledore knew that Voldemort had made a comeback.

This old man had already made relevant plans in his mind, waiting for Voldemort to fall into a trap and then get rid of him.

In fact, it was at this time that Dumbledore began to doubt the secret of Voldemort's immortality when he discovered that Voldemort was so weak that only his soul was left, but could not be killed.

After all, Horcruxes are definitely not the only way to make people immortal in this world, but only Horcruxes should be so effective.

When Voldemort's notebook appeared in the next school year, Dumbledore finally confirmed that Voldemort had used forbidden black magic to create "horcruxes".

From then on, Dumbledore began to arrange various new plans around Voldemort's Horcruxes.

But Dumbledore doesn't know this yet. After all, he is still a human being, and after all, it is impossible for him to predict everything.

If he was really that perfect, I'm afraid he wouldn't have been tricked by Voldemort and had to die in the end.

There are many Harry Potter fans who write Dumbledore too perfectly and make him some kind of White Devil, and he seems to have no tricks left. Obviously this is quite ridiculous.

If he was really that powerful, he would not have allowed Voldemort to be born, nor would he have had to die.

This old wizard is powerful now, but he still has something he can't let go of.

He could not let go of Voldemort, who had become a tiger because of his own negligence, nor could he let go of Hogwarts, where he had worked for most of his life.

To this end, Dumbledore can make any compromise.

In Hao Fang's view, after Dumbledore said those words, the old man was actually compromising.

He wanted to go back as soon as possible, no matter what the cost.

Yes, Dumbledore doesn't even negotiate the price anymore, the subtext is that you can set whatever price you want.

Although Hao Fang had just said that he would help Dumbledore deal with Voldemort, everyone knew that this could not be taken completely seriously.

If you don’t pay anything, do you still want people to do things for nothing?

Because of such a sentence, Dumbledore may have already thought clearly that Hao Fang and others must have something to ask for when they come.

And he himself is willing to pay the price in order to go back.

It can be said that the two parties have reached a tacit understanding and have hit it off virtually.

Hao Fang only vaguely understood these things, and he was not yet smart enough to fully understand them.

Alice and Dr. Charles did not understand this kind of negotiation skills, and they did not hear Dumbledore's subtext at all.

But Hao Fang still represented their group and gave the most correct answer: "As long as you are ready, we can go back at any time!"

Dumbledore smiled, feeling much more cordial than before. He clapped his hands and said, "No need to prepare, just do it now."

"Okay." Hao Fang nodded and said, "Follow me to the transfer station first, and then I will take you back!"

After he finished speaking, there was an extra book in his hand, and he threw it to Dumbledore.

When Dumbledore saw this familiar book of links, he couldn't help but be startled and said: "This is..."

"Yes, this is a voucher to go to my private world." Hao Fang smiled, "You have used it last time, so you naturally know where it will take you."

Dumbledore suddenly understood the meaning of the so-called transfer station.

"Of course, you'd better not try randomly like last time." Hao Fang reminded again, "Last time, my world didn't have any protection, so I let you invade in casually. But now, I'm afraid that you can casually invade."

If you try randomly, you will be transported into the turbulence of time and space..."

Dumbledore's expression became solemn and he asked directly: "Then how should I use it?"

"You don't have to worry about this... I will help you activate its function, you just need to hold it." Hao Fang smiled, "So, are you ready now?"

Dumbledore nodded immediately.

At the same time, Hao Fang, Alice, and Dr. Charles looked at each other, and then each of them had a link book in their hands and started it at the same time.

Dumbledore's link book was also activated by Hao Fang.

The group of people turned into light and disappeared in place.



"This is..." When Dumbledore just arrived in the original world, he felt an unprecedented sense of oppression. Most of his strength was suppressed, and he became extremely weak.

And when he saw clearly what the original world looked like, he couldn't believe it even more.

Obviously the last time he came here, it was just empty, with almost nothing.

But this time, there is an extra sun in the sky, the earth has also changed, and there has been construction here, so it is completely different.

It didn’t take long, right? It’s already changed beyond recognition?

Dumbledore thought for a moment and vaguely understood.

Since Hao Fang can travel through different worlds, and this world seems to be private to him, no matter how strange it seems, he should not be surprised.

Dumbledore even felt that it was a bit strange that he had come to someone else's territory and could invade at will like last time.

It was as if he had entered the inner earth world, and that world was limiting his strength.

But this time, the original world gave him more restrictions, which made Dumbledore feel more realistic.

As an outsider, if you still want to be treated like a local, you are thinking too much.

After returning to his own world, Hao Fang obviously became more confident. He immediately asked Dumbledore: "How do you feel? This world of mine..."

Dumbledore nodded and said, "Except for suppressing me a little harder, everything else is fine."

Hao Fang chuckled, he naturally knew the reason.

In fact, this is because the world is too weak and is suppressing outsiders even more.

For example, a powerful world may not care about unexpected comers, because they have a strong foundation and have no guilty conscience at all.

But this is not absolute. There will definitely be some worlds that do not welcome any outsiders, regardless of whether the world itself is strong or weak.

"What do you think if Voldemort is tricked into here and suppressed here?" Hao Fang asked tentatively.

Dumbledore was surprised at first, but then shook his head and said, "Voldemort is too suspicious. He will not be fooled like this."

Hao Fang thought for a while and then nodded.

Yes, Voldemort is indeed suspicious. After all, his rule relies entirely on darkness and violence. Even to control his subordinates, he must use the Dark Mark.

It is really not easy for such a person to be fooled.

In the original plot, Voldemort's body was destroyed due to an accident.

Then, his final death was also due to an accident.

In other words, that is the power of fate!

If it weren't for accidents and fate, it really wouldn't be easy to plot against Voldemort through normal means, and it might be used in reverse.

Just like Harry Potter, he was able to sense something about Voldemort because of his status as a Horcrux, but he was exploited by Voldemort in turn.
